Re: [ITP]: Berkley DB v2


Nicholas Wourms wrote:

Gerrit Haase and I will be submitting various versions of the Berkeley DB for inclusion into the cygwin distribution. We begin with the Berkley DB2, which is the first major revision of the original Berkeley DB. The version of db-2 is 2.7.7, which is the last stable version released for the db-2 line. There are many projects which can use the db-2, one such project being xemacs. Our intent is to provide the standard database api's in the same manner as redhat

No. -I/usr/include/db2 (to get the right headers when compiling) and -ldb2 when linking is the only way to ALWAYS get db2.

There is no /usr/lib/db2/ directory.

If you don't specify any special -I dir for db headers (e.g. only look in the "standard" /usr/include place) and just use -ldb as your link flag -- you'll get "the most recent" db library, thanks to the symlinks. Right now, that's db2. Later it will be db3.3, and even later you'll get db4.0.
